Product Description

Large and in charge, this Timex 1440 Sports digital watch (model T5H091) features a full-sized, durable silver resin watch case with black top ring and easy-to-access side buttons. The dial features a large, easily readable digital time display, and it has an analog day-of-the-week display and large digital date readout at the top of the dial. Sport timing features include a 24-hour chronograph and 24-hour countdown timer. Other features include a daily alarm, dual time zone display, and water resistance to 50 meters (165 feet). It's completed by a buckle clasp.

The Indiglo night-light uniformly lights the surface of the watch dial using patented blue electroluminescent lighting technology. It uses less battery power than most other watch illumination systems, enabling your watch battery to last longer.

Great watch for the price
 
Review Date: February 15, 2009
Reviewer: ShebBadger, Sheboygan, WI USA
I bought this watch specifically to wear while working out. I particularly like that the stopwatch feature is quite large (large second display up to 30 minutes). For stretching exercises this allows easy reading.

Also, the Indigo feature works better than other Timex watches I've owned. The light stays on for a couple of seconds and then slowly fades out. So for checking time/stopwatch in low light you have time to read the numbers.

The watch is stylish and for the price you can't go wrong.
